Samsung to reveal 11.6in Galaxy Tab at Mobile World Congress?

We’re still getting used to the idea that Samsung might not launch the Galaxy S III at Mobile World Congress after all, but it might have another high-specced beast up its sleeve.

German site Tabtech reckons Samsung is planning to reveal a spanking new Galaxy Tab, with a mammoth 11.6in display. That’d make it the world’s biggest Android tablet, right?

Other rumoured specs for the Samsung Galaxy Tab 11.6 include a 2GHz dual-core Exynos 5250 processor, and an eye-melting resolution of 2560x1600. The screen will also welcome stylus input.

The rumour is corroborated by Android and Me’s Taylor Wembley, who was asked to delete pictures he took of a prototype Exynos 5250-powered tablet at CES in Vegas. Said prototype had Ice Cream Sandwich (Android 4.0) on board.

To be honest, we’d rather see the Samsung Galaxy S III. Also, this will be the fifth Galaxy Tab (7, 7.7, 8.9, 10.1 and now 11.6) from Samsung, adding to our concerns that Sammo might “do an HTC” in 2012.

Fujitsu lifts the lid on Stylistic Android tablet

If there’s one thing we’re really looking forward to at Mobile World Congress, it’s a host of spanking new much-the-same Android tablets. You really never can have enough of those bad boys.

Well, good news if you can’t wait another three weeks, as Fujitsu has fired out a press release detailing the Stylistic M350/CA2.

The press release is fairly light on the spec front, but tells us the Fujitsu Stylistic M350/CA2 will weigh in at 420g with a 7in 1024x600 display, “Android OS” (thought to be Gingerbread) and 6.1 hours of battery life.

Fujitsu is keen to emphasise its "NX! Input powered by ATOK" character input technology, allowing users to switch between numeric, QWERTY and hand-written input.

The Japanese manufacturer suggests that the Stylistic M350/CA2 would be ideal “as a mobile sales terminal, as a handset for displaying digital catalogs at a retail store, and as an e-book reader in a classroom setting.” Exciting.
